19.01.2022 If you haven't received your ballot pack in the mail by today, please call the Warrnambool VEC office on 1300 141 492 to arrange a replacement. If your ballot p...ack has been lost or damaged, you can call the above number to get a replacement too. By 6pm on Friday October 23, your vote needs to be either in the mail (Local mail clearance times vary. Check your local mail clearance times so your vote is in the mail on time) or delivered to the VEC election office at 110 Liebig Street. Find out more about voting, exemptions and other FAQs at the VEC website: www.vec.vic.gov.au//2020-local-council-election/how-to-vote

03.01.2022 Before I committed to standing for council the questions I asked myself were as follows; Are you passionate about achieving better outcomes for your community? Do you have good connections with your local community? Do you have good listening skills, and the ability to get your message across?... Are you a person of honesty and integrity? Are you reliable and trustworthy? I believe I have all of the above skills and that in order to understand and represent local views and priorities, you need to build strong relationships and encourage local people to make their views known and engage with you and the council. Good communication and engagement is central to being an effective councillor and to be able to communicate council decisions that affect them. Councillors who understand the importance of working together tend to have a better success rate at influencing decisions and achieving their priorities during their elected term. I am prepared to strive to be a councillor that the community can trust and respect. Vote 1 Debbie Arnott.



03.01.2022 There has been a lot of talk among candidates about what they would like to do for Warrnambool. There has been some fantastic and creative ideas. However I do think the new council will need to focus on WHAT they can do. Budget restraints will dictate what is going to be possible to achieve. A better outcome might be to consider the smaller and more urgent projects that can benefit the community. This is what I would like to initially put energy into. ... Vote 1 Debbie Arnott
